Wienerberger is a leading international manufacturer of brick and ceramic roof tiles, with more than 16,000 employees and 197 production sites in 29 countries. At its location in Heteren, the manufacturer produces facing bricks and paving bricks. The finished product is placed on the storage site ready for transport using forklift trucks. Wienerberger Heteren has four forklift trucks for this, in different weight classes. The trucks are deployed on average 14 hours a day, outside and inside.

Going zero-emissions with Hyster® J3.5XN

Wienerberger was looking for an emission-free truck that would reduce CO2 emissions. The new electric truck had to be able to run for the full 14 hours over two shifts and without changing the battery. The company also wanted to switch to an alternative energy source for reduction of CO2 emissions.

Local Hyster distribution partner Heffiq supplied a Hyster J3.5XN equipped with maintenance-free lithium-ion technology.

Convenient opportunity charging

The robust 3.5-tonne electric four-wheel J3.5XN is designed for intensive, demanding use with powerful, maintenance-free AC motors that guarantee optimum performance.

The Hyster forklift with lithium-ion battery can be opportunity charged without harming the battery life. The truck is put on to charge at any time, such as during coffee or lunch breaks. Charging is also faster. Within a few minutes, the battery is sufficiently charged to continue working without any problems. In addition, the battery is maintenance-free.

Robust lithium-ion forklift to support operators

For optimum driving comfort, the Hyster J3.5XN features an ergonomic seat and mini-lever controls. Furthermore, the truck offers a low step, a spacious seat with plenty of foot space and an excellent view of both the load and the surrounding areas, thanks to the well-considered placement of the lifting chains and the hydraulic hoses. The steering column is easily adjustable and can be adapted to the wishes and posture of the driver. A memory mode and synchronised steering options allow the driver to get in and out of the truck quickly and easily.

As space can be tight in the factory and in the yard, the truck also features the Hyster Zero Turning radius system. This results in an extremely tight turning circle and – in combination with the maintenance-free, mechanical Hyster Stability Mechanism – improves stability when travelling over uneven surfaces.
